6 99%Game Brain Scoremusic, gameplaygraphics, grinding99% User Score 868 reviewsTouhou Kouryuudou: Unconnected Marketeers is the eighteenth official installment of the Touhou Project. It was announced by ZUN on the Touhou Project news blog Touhou Yomoyama News, February 2021. A playable demo is scheduled for release on March 21st the same year, at Reitaisai 18, and the full version is scheduled to be released in May.
